在当今数字化时代,大数据分析已成为企业决策、市场预测、用户行为研究等领域的重要工具。大数据分析是指通过收集、处理和分析海量数据,从中提取有价值的信息和洞察,以支持业务决策和战略制定。其核心在于数据的采集、存储、处理、分析和可视化,以及如何将这些信息转化为实际应用。
随着数据量的爆炸式增长,掌握大数据分析技能已成为职场竞争力的重要组成部分。本文将从基础知识、学习路径、实践应用、工具选择以及职业发展等方面,系统阐述如何有效学习大数据分析,同时融入易搜职考网的品牌理念,为读者提供实用的学习建议和职业发展方向。 一、大数据分析的基础知识 大数据分析的核心在于理解数据的结构、来源、处理方式以及分析方法。学习大数据分析的第一步是掌握数据的基本概念,包括数据类型(结构化、非结构化、半结构化)、数据来源(如传感器、社交媒体、交易记录等)以及数据存储方式(如关系型数据库、NoSQL数据库、分布式文件系统等)。 除了这些之外呢,大数据分析涉及数据处理技术,如数据清洗、数据转换、数据集成和数据建模。数据清洗是去除冗余、错误和不一致数据的过程,确保数据的准确性和完整性;数据转换则涉及将不同格式的数据转换为统一格式,便于后续分析;数据集成是指将来自不同来源的数据整合到一个统一的数据仓库中,以支持统一分析。 在数据分析方面,常见的方法包括描述性分析(描述过去的数据趋势)、预测性分析(预测在以后趋势)和规范性分析(指导决策)。
例如,通过描述性分析,企业可以了解用户行为模式,而通过预测性分析,企业可以预测市场需求,从而制定更有效的营销策略。 二、学习大数据分析的路径 学习大数据分析需要系统性地掌握相关知识,并结合实践不断提升技能。
下面呢是学习大数据分析的几个关键步骤: 1.掌握编程语言 大数据分析离不开编程语言的支持。Python 是目前最流行的编程语言之一,因其丰富的库(如Pandas、NumPy、Scikit-learn等)和良好的社区支持,广泛用于数据分析和可视化。掌握 Python 是学习大数据分析的基础。 2.学习数据处理工具 大数据分析需要使用多种工具,如Hadoop、Spark、Hive、Flink等。Hadoop 是分布式计算框架,用于处理大规模数据;Spark 是基于内存的计算框架,适合处理实时数据;Hive 是用于结构化数据存储和查询的工具。掌握这些工具是进行大数据分析的关键。 3.学习数据分析方法 大数据分析的核心在于数据的处理和分析方法。学习常见的数据分析方法,如数据挖掘、机器学习、数据可视化等,是提升分析能力的重要途径。
例如,通过机器学习算法,企业可以预测用户流失风险,从而优化用户留存策略。 4.学习数据可视化 数据可视化是将分析结果以图表、仪表盘等形式呈现,便于决策者理解。学习使用Tableau、Power BI、D3.js等工具,能够提升数据分析的直观性和表达力。 5.实践项目与案例分析 通过实际项目和案例分析,能够加深对大数据分析的理解。
例如,可以尝试分析某电商平台的用户行为数据,预测销售趋势,或者分析社交媒体舆情,为企业提供市场洞察。 三、大数据分析的实践应用 大数据分析的应用场景非常广泛,涵盖了多个行业,包括金融、医疗、零售、制造、教育等。 1.金融行业 在金融领域,大数据分析用于风险评估、欺诈检测、市场预测等。
例如,银行可以通过分析用户的交易数据,识别异常交易行为,从而降低欺诈风险。 2.医疗行业 在医疗领域,大数据分析可用于疾病预测、药物研发、患者管理等。
例如,通过分析患者的电子健康记录,医生可以预测患者的病情发展趋势,从而制定更有效的治疗方案。 3.零售行业 在零售行业,大数据分析用于库存管理、个性化推荐、客户行为分析等。
例如,通过分析消费者的购买历史和浏览行为,企业可以优化库存,提高客户满意度。 4.制造业 在制造业,大数据分析用于设备维护、生产优化、供应链管理等。
例如,通过分析设备的运行数据,企业可以预测设备故障,从而减少停机时间,提高生产效率。 四、大数据分析工具的选择与使用 选择合适的大数据分析工具,是提升分析效率和质量的关键。常见的大数据分析工具包括: 1.Hadoop Hadoop 是一个开源的分布式计算框架,适用于处理大规模数据。它由HDFS(分布式文件系统)和MapReduce(分布式计算)组成,适合处理结构化和非结构化数据。 2.Spark Spark 是一个基于内存的计算框架,适合处理实时数据和大规模数据集。它比Hadoop更高效,适合处理实时数据流和复杂计算任务。 3.Hive Hive 是Hadoop生态系统中的数据仓库工具,用于处理结构化数据,支持SQL查询,适合进行数据存储和分析。 4.Tableau Tableau 是一个强大的数据可视化工具,能够将分析结果以图表、仪表盘等形式呈现,适合用于商业决策支持。 5.Python Python 是大数据分析的首选语言,因其丰富的库和良好的社区支持,适合进行数据清洗、分析和可视化。 在选择工具时,应根据具体需求和数据规模进行选择。
例如,如果数据量较大且需要高性能计算,可以选择Spark;如果数据以结构化形式存储,可以选择Hive或Hadoop。 五、大数据分析的职业发展路径 掌握大数据分析技能,能够为个人职业发展提供更多机会。
下面呢是大数据分析相关的职业发展方向: 1.数据分析师 数据分析师负责收集、处理和分析数据,为企业提供数据支持。这一职位通常需要掌握数据分析工具和方法,具备良好的沟通能力和逻辑思维能力。 2.数据科学家 数据科学家是高级数据分析人员,负责构建数据分析模型,进行预测和决策支持。这一职位通常需要较强的编程能力和数学背景。 3.数据工程师 数据工程师负责构建和维护数据管道,确保数据能够高效地传输和处理。这一职位需要掌握大数据工具和技术,具备良好的系统设计能力。 4.数据产品经理 数据产品经理负责将数据分析结果转化为产品功能,优化用户体验。这一职位需要具备数据分析能力、产品思维和商业洞察力。 5.数据可视化设计师 数据可视化设计师负责将分析结果以直观的方式呈现,帮助决策者理解数据。这一职位需要掌握数据可视化工具和设计原则。 六、学习大数据分析的建议 学习大数据分析是一项系统性工程,需要持续学习和实践。
下面呢是几点学习建议: 1.制定学习计划 学习大数据分析需要分阶段进行,从基础概念到工具使用,再到项目实践。制定合理的学习计划,有助于提高学习效率。 2.多实践,多动手 大数据分析的核心在于实践,只有通过实际项目和案例,才能真正掌握技能。建议通过开源项目、在线课程或实习机会进行实践。 3.持续学习与更新知识 大数据技术更新迅速,学习过程中应关注新技术和工具的发展,如AI、机器学习、数据湖等。 4.加入专业社区 加入大数据分析相关的社区和论坛,如Stack Overflow、GitHub、Kaggle等,能够获取更多学习资源和交流机会。 5.关注行业动态 了解大数据分析在不同行业的应用趋势,有助于提升学习方向的针对性和实用性。 七、归结起来说 大数据分析是数字化时代的重要技能,掌握它不仅能够提升个人职业竞争力,还能为企业发展带来显著价值。学习大数据分析需要系统性地掌握基础知识、工具使用、数据分析方法和实践应用。通过持续学习、实践和更新知识,能够不断提升自己的专业能力,为在以后的职业发展打下坚实基础。 易搜职考网致力于为大数据分析学习者提供全面、实用的学习资源和职业发展建议,帮助大家顺利掌握大数据分析技能,实现职业成长。